Following on from their successful ‘Avenge at York Hall’ double-header in September, Neilson Boxing are back at the iconic venue known as the ‘home of British boxing’ this November. Billy Addington and Bradley Townsend will top the bill for a chance to win a British title and a Lonsdale Belt. Neilson Boxing tickets are on sale now.
The super-lightweight stakes are high for Billy Addington (13-4-4) and Bradley Townsend (18-0-0) who go toe-to-toe in east London in a British title eliminator. Addington is looking to bounce back from a points defeat to Jake Henty back in March. The unbeaten Townsend, who hails from Oxford, is aiming to bring up his nineteenth win on the spin in the pro ranks. A showdown with super-lightweight British champion Jack Rafferty awaits for the winner.
Also on the bill is a match-up between Muzamiru Kakande v Asinia Byfield for the Commonwealth silver welterweight title, while Alfie Gaskin and Morgan Sellamuthu will lock horns at middleweight with a Commonwealth youth super title at stake.
